And for this week of the Pillow Along, I was asked to use the Cathedral Garden Block and a Halloween theme to make up a Pillow.  


And here is what I made!!!  Isn't this just the cutest!!!!   Of course, I always have to go off a little and I made a table runner instead of a pillow.  I can't wait to use it this year!!   This is the same Cathedral Garden Block from A Scrapbook of Quilts I just played with the fabric layout to make the word boo!!   And I think it is just so fun how it worked out.   


I used Fig Tree scraps in Orange and Cream and Grunge Black for the letters and the binding.  And rather than do each block in one fabric, I went for an all over scrappy look.  I think it really adds to making the boo pop all the more.



And when it came time to quilt it, I thought it would be fun to add to the Halloween effect by quilting spiderwebs.   This was my first time trying them, and I am super pleased with how they turned out.  Not all my echoing is perfect, but it works :)  I even added a little spider in the center o, so fun!!!    


And this Pillow Along  post wouldn't be complete without a diagram.   I am hoping you all will want to quilt along and make your own Boo Cathedral Garden Pillow or Table Runner as well.  
 You will need a copy of A Scrapbook of Quilts and use the directions for the Large Cathedral Garden Block!!!   I used 5 Orange Fig Tree Fat Quarters and 4 Cream Fig Tree Fat Quarters  and 1/2 yard of Black Grunge .  But you can totally use Scraps or more Fat Quarters for variety.  

Make 8 Blocks total in the following fabric layouts of blocks.  

                               Block 1 Layout - Make 1                           Block 2 Layout - Make 4
          

                              Block 3 Layout - Make 1                              Block 4 Layout- Make 1
         

Block 5 Layout - Make 1

Layout your Blocks as shown and sew the blocks into rows and the rows into the pillow top or table runner top.  


I added a 2" finished Scrappy Cream border to my Table Runner and then quilted and bound it.  It finishes at 20" x 36", perfect for a table runner of a lumbar pillow.  And just like that, you have an awesome Boo Cathedral Garden Pillow or Table Runner!!!
